This might be an ideal target for a Senate vote on a 502B resolution on cluster bombs in Ukraine. Introduction of a privileged 502B resolution in the Senate starts a clock. If Senators wanted to have a vote between Sept. 30-Oct. 8th, a good target for the introduction of a bill might be September 21, the UN International Day of Peace. A 502B resolution is a blank canvas. Senators introducing the bill can write whatever they agree to write on the blank canvas. This is an advantage of a 502B resolution over a privileged resolution under the War Powers Resolution or the Arms Export Control Act, where there is a structure Senators have to follow. A 502B resolution is a set of questions the Administration has to answer within 30 days of the passage of the bill. Senators can put any question in the 502B resolution that Senators want answered. They can put questions about cluster bombs, they can put questions about "ceasefire." They can put questions about the Saudi use of U.S. cluster bombs in Yemen between March 2015 and June 2016, when the Sullivan-Blinken gang who signed the Yemen mea culpa letter were in charge, just as they are now. Look at the Saudi-Yemen 502B resolution that Senators Murphy, Lee, and Durbin introduced in March. There's a question there about the Saudi government protecting Saudi nationals from U.S. justice for crimes committed in the United States. What does that have to do with "human rights in Saudi Arabia?" Doesn't matter. Senators can address whatever they want in a 502B resolution. The only constraint is that the provisions have to be framed as questions for the Administration. Robert Naiman ? As a candidate for President in 2020, Joe Biden promised to ?end endless wars,? including the Saudi war in Yemen. These promises are enshrined in the 2020 Democratic Platform, where it says : ?Democrats will deliver on this overdue commitment to end the forever wars? Democrats will end support for the Saudi-led war in Yemen and help bring the war to an end... Democrats believe that the United States should support diplomatic efforts?not block them.? Although President Biden deserves credit for bringing home the troops from Afghanistan and pushing for a ceasefire in Yemen, these 2020 Democratic Platform promises remain largely unfulfilled. As recently reported by *The Nation* , the U.S.-enabled Saudi blockade on people in Yemen continues, while the Intercept has reported that the Biden Administration is now slow-walking diplomacy to end the war. U.S. troops remain in Syria. The Biden Administration continues to take escalatory steps in Ukraine it had previously refused, such as its recent decision to transfer cluster bombs to Ukraine ? in violation of the cluster bomb treaty and despite the opposition of 150 Members of the House and the U.S. Conference of Catholic Bishops. As the Netanyahu government takes unprecedented actions that threaten democracy in Israel, Israeli democracy activists complain that the Biden Administration is not speaking up forcefully enough against this to stop the Israeli government?s present course.
